2     device iterator for locating a particular device.
3 </p></div><div class="refsynopsisdiv"><h2>Synopsis</h2><div class="funcsynopsis"><table border="0" class="funcprototype-table" summary="Function synopsis" style="cellspacing: 0; cellpadding: 0;"><tr><td><code class="funcdef">struct device * <b class="fsfunc">device_find_child </b>(</code></td><td>struct device * <var class="pdparam">parent</var>, </td></tr><tr><td>&#160;</td><td>void * <var class="pdparam">data</var>, </td></tr><tr><td>&#160;</td><td>int (*<var class="pdparam">match</var>)
4     <code>(</code>struct device *dev, void *data<code>)</code><code>)</code>;</td></tr></table><div class="funcprototype-spacer">&#160;</div></div></div><div class="refsect1"><a name="idp1109374308"></a><h2>Arguments</h2><div class="variablelist"><dl class="variablelist"><dt><span class="term"><em class="parameter"><code>parent</code></em></span></dt><dd><p>
5     parent struct device
6    </p></dd><dt><span class="term"><em class="parameter"><code>data</code></em></span></dt><dd><p>
7     Data to pass to match function
8    </p></dd><dt><span class="term"><em class="parameter"><code>match</code></em></span></dt><dd><p>
9     Callback function to check device
10    </p></dd></dl></div></div><div class="refsect1"><a name="idp1109377996"></a><h2>Description</h2><p>
11   This is similar to the <code class="function">device_for_each_child</code> function above, but it
12   returns a reference to a device that is 'found' for later use, as
13   determined by the <em class="parameter"><code>match</code></em> callback.
14   </p><p>
15
16   The callback should return 0 if the device doesn't match and non-zero
17   if it does.  If the callback returns non-zero and a reference to the
18   current device can be obtained, this function will return to the caller
19   and not iterate over any more devices.
20</p></div><div class="refsect1"><a name="idp1109379868"></a><h2>NOTE</h2><p>
21   you will need to drop the reference with <code class="function">put_device</code> after use.
